The bank’s officers and employees observed a two-hour pen break on Monday (June 8) to press for seven demands, including the resignation of chairman Khurshid Alam of Islami Bank Bangladesh PLC. The program was held from 10 am to 12 noon at the call of the Islami Bank Conscious Customer Forum. During this time, banking activities in various branches and sub-branches of the country,...
